EVANGELIZE? WHY AND HOW? – PS MODESTINE CASTANOU

GO! WHY AND HOW?

All authority has been given to me in heaven and on earth. Go, make disciples of all nations!

Yes, Jesus gave a clear command. It is not a suggestion, not an option. It is a divine mandate! But today, why do so many Christians still hesitate? Why is this mission often relegated to the background?

There is a spiritual urgency, an absolute necessity to obey this instruction from Christ. For how will the world hear if no one speaks? How will captives be set free if no one proclaims the Truth to them?

Romans 10:13-14: For, “Everyone who calls on the name of the Lord will be saved.” How then will they call on him in whom they have not believed? And how are they to believe in him of whom they have never heard? And how are they to hear without someone preaching?

Jesus is sending us. He sends us as messengers of His kingdom, bearers of news that transforms lives, that snatches souls from darkness and leads them into the light.

So the real question is: WILL YOU GO?

THOSE WHO HEARD THE CALL

In Matthew 28, we see women rising before dawn to go and see Jesus’ tomb. Two women, not men. Two women who were not afraid to be seen, who were not afraid of reprisals. Where were the men? Hiding, locked away, paralyzed by fear.

But these women were the first to see the resurrection! They were the first to hear the mission: “Go, tell my disciples!” They did not wait. They set out immediately.

God is looking for willing hearts, men and women who hear His voice and obey without hesitation. The enemy does everything to prevent you from responding to this mission. He makes you believe it is the task of pastors or evangelists. He makes you believe you are not ready. But the truth is that every believer has received this command. It is the responsibility of EVERYONE!

HOW TO GO?

Fear, doubts, excuses… Many want to but do not dare. Yet, Jesus sets the example! For three years, He did not stay safely in a temple. He went! He traveled through cities, through villages. He did not wait for souls to come to Him—He went to find them.

Luke 19:10: For the Son of Man came to seek and to save the lost.

He did not just proclaim in a fixed place. He knew that some would never come on their own. He walked, He traveled the land, He went to those who were marginalized, rejected, broken. And today, He calls you to do the same.

  • By living Christ where you are. Your testimony, your way of life, your attitude can already be a powerful message.
  • By daring to speak. Some are just waiting for one word to be touched.
  • Through prayer. Ask the Holy Spirit to guide you.
  • By using strategies. Use social media, friendly gatherings. Do not limit yourself!
